Overview

Oppo Reno15 is a mid-high tier [smartphone](/trend/best-smartphones-2026/) featuring a Snapdragon 7 Gen 4 for efficient performance and a 50 MP selfie camera with autofocus for high-quality vlogging, aimed at visual creators who prioritize video aesthetics and battery longevity. Released in early 2026, it competes with the latest mid-range offerings from Samsung and Xiaomi by focusing heavily on specialized optics and extreme durability.

We have analyzed the hardware trajectory for the upcoming 2026 season, and it is clear that the focus has shifted from raw megapixels to functional versatility. This handset manages to pack a massive 6500 mAh battery into a chassis that measures only 7.8mm thick, presenting a significant engineering feat for users who spend hours recording on location. The inclusion of an IP69 rating also marks a transition into a more rugged era for the Reno lineup, ensuring that steam and high-pressure water jets won't compromise the internals.

The Front-Facing Camera Revolution


The primary focus for any creator using the Oppo Reno15 is the front-facing 50 MP ultrawide sensor. Unlike standard [mid-range phones](/trend/best-mid-range-phones-2026/) that use fixed-focus lenses for selfies, this model utilizes a 50 MP sensor with Autofocus (AF). For creators who frequently walk and talk while filming, the AF ensures that the face remains sharp regardless of distance from the lens. This eliminates the 'hunting' effect seen in lower-end devices and provides a professional look to vlogs.

Recording at 4K@60fps on the front camera is no longer a luxury but a requirement for modern social platforms. The 18mm focal length provides a wide enough field of view to include backgrounds without the awkward 'floating head' effect. When we look at the gyro-EIS implementation, the electronic stabilization uses data from the internal sensors to crop the frame intelligently. This results in walking footage that looks almost as if it were shot on a gimbal, which is vital for the 'run-and-gun' style of content creation.

Fluidity in Every Swipe


Running ColorOS 16 on top of Android 16, the software experience is optimized for the Snapdragon 7 Gen 4 architecture. This 4nm chipset utilizes a core cluster consisting of Cortex-720 and Cortex-520 cores. The Cortex-720 acts as the heavy lifter for demanding apps, while the Cortex-520 manages background tasks to keep the system responsive. Users will find that the UI remains fluid even when high-bitrate video files are rendering in the background.

One potential annoyance in modern UIs is bloatware, and we expect ColorOS 16 to maintain its traditional suite of pre-installed tools. However, the efficiency of UFS 3.1 storage helps mitigate any perceived slowdowns. Application launch times are swift, and the Write Booster technology ensures that saving large 4K files from the camera app to the internal memory happens without the dreaded 'saving' spinner. The 12GB of RAM is more than sufficient for keeping social media management apps, video editors, and browsers open simultaneously.

The 6500 mAh Endurance Monster


Perhaps the most shocking specification is the battery capacity. At 6500 mAh, this device outclasses almost every flagship released in the last twelve months. For a visual creator, battery life is the ultimate currency. A full day of shooting high-brightness video usually kills most [phones](/trend/best-premium-phones-2026/) by 4:00 PM. We anticipate that this model can comfortably survive a 10-hour shooting day with room to spare.

The 80W wired charging is equally impressive, utilizing the Universal Fast Charging Specification (UFCS). This means you aren't strictly tethered to the proprietary Oppo brick to get fast speeds; compatible third-party chargers will also juice the device quickly. Reaching a full charge in roughly 50 minutes for a battery this large is a remarkable efficiency metric. It effectively removes the 'range anxiety' associated with mobile filmmaking.

Mobile Editing Powerhouse


Editing 4K video on a mobile device requires two things: a great screen and a capable GPU. The 6.59-inch AMOLED panel hits 1200 nits in High Brightness Mode (HBM), making it legible even in the harsh midday sun of an outdoor shoot. The HDR10+ certification ensures that when you're color-grading your footage, the highlights and shadows are represented with accurate dynamic range.

The Adreno 722 GPU is specifically tuned for the Snapdragon 7 series' mid-high tier performance. It handles the 1B color depth of the display with ease. For editors using apps like CapCut or LumaFusion, the rendering speeds will be noticeably faster than the previous generation. While it won't rival the Snapdragon 8 series 'Ultra' flagships for 8K exports, for the 1080p and 4K vertical content that defines the current era, it is more than capable.

Low Light Mastery


Low light video has historically been the weak point of mid-range sensors. However, the Color Spectrum Sensor included here acts as a hardware-level assistant for the ISP. It measures the ambient light temperature to ensure that even under flickering streetlights or warm indoor lamps, the white balance remains natural. This prevents the 'yellowish' or 'blueish' tint that often ruins amateur night vlogs.

Combined with the f/1.8 aperture on the main 50 MP wide lens and OIS, the camera can pull in more light with longer shutter speeds without causing motion blur in the video. The 8 MP ultrawide is the weakest link here due to its smaller sensor size, but it still features Autofocus, which allows it to double as a macro lens for close-up detail shots of textures or products. For the most part, creators will want to stick to the main and telephoto lenses for serious work after the sun goes down.
